Africa
Nigeria: NGOs allege human rights abuses by Wilmar International, including lack of adequate compensation & damage to water supply

Environmental Rights Action/Friends of the Earth Nigeria; Science Daily

  • we invited Wilmar Intl. to respond - response provided
  • letter by community committee also provided
So. Africa: NGOs call on Engie to divest from coal-fired power station due to concerns about negative health, environmental & climate change impacts

Centre for Environmental Rights; Earthlife Africa;  Science Daily

  • we invited Engie to respond - it did not
Kenya: Local authority to seek compensation from UK for colonial-era displacement for commercial agriculture

Standard Digital (Kenya)
